Netbackup Client Install Needed for Windows Server

kevin_b1
Level 3

Hello,

We are using Netbackup 7.5.0.4 in a Linux RedHat environment. However, we have several Windows 2008/2012 Servers that we need to backup All_LOCAL_DRIVES. From what I know you need Netbackup Client installed on the Windows server in order for Netbackup to communicate for the backups. Can someone confirm if this is the correct Client to download/install from Symantec File Connect?

Netbackup_7.5_Win_zip.1of2

Netbackup_7.5_Win_zip.2of2

Correct. Use that for W2008 clients. Join those 2 files (following instructions in the Readme file on FileConnect) and extract. No need to 'drill down' into subfolders - simply run Browser.exe in the root of the extracted media. You will be presented with a choice of server or client istallation. Full instructions in NBU Installation Guide. You can find links to all manuals in 'Handy NBU Links' in my signature.

That would be the server installation files, when you extract the files you will find a folder named PC_Clnt with two additional folder x86 (32 bit) and x64 (64 bit).  These are the binaries that you will need to install the client software package.

Looks about right, they need concatenating together to form a good fully formed zip, details with the download. Oh and 2012 isnt supported til 7.5.0.6 according to scl

http://www.symantec.com/business/support/library/BUSINESS/xCL/TECH76648/nbu_7x_scl.html#operating_sy...

so you will probably need to upgrade the master a touch.

NB_7.5.0.6 Full Installer Package for W2012:
http://www.symantec.com/docs/TECH204661 

Base 7.5 install will not work.

This client version will work with 7.5.0.4 master.
See Version Compatibility TN: http://www.symantec.com/docs/TECH29677
